Common Spam Call Types
in India
- Fake KYC update calls impersonating banks or UPI apps
- CBI/police impersonation calls threatening arrest
- TRAI SIM disconnection threats
- Courier/customs fraud and OTP phishing scams
How to Identify Scam
Numbers
- Caller claims urgency or threatens consequences
- Requests personal info, PINs, or OTP codes
- Offers that sound too good to be true
- Unknown numbers calling repeatedly

India's country code is +91. When dialing from abroad, use +91 followed by the 10-digit number without the leading zero. For example, a Mumbai number 022-XXXXXXXX becomes +91-22-XXXXXXXX internationally, and a mobile number 98XXXXXXXX becomes +91-98XXXXXXXX.
Indian mobile numbers are 10 digits starting with 6, 7, 8, or 9. Due to Mobile Number Portability (MNP), users can switch carriers while keeping their number. Jio numbers commonly start with 62-69 and 70-79, Airtel with 70-79, 80-84, and 90-99, Vi (Vodafone Idea) with 70-79 and 90-99, and BSNL with 70, 74, 75, and 94-95.

Search the number on WhoseNo and submit a report describing the call. For serious fraud, report to the National Cyber Crime Reporting Portal at cybercrime.gov.in or call 1930. You can also report spam calls using the DND (Do Not Disturb) service by sending an SMS to 1909 or through the TRAI DND app.

Common scams include fake calls from "KYC update required" impersonating banks or Paytm/Google Pay, CBI/police impersonation threatening arrest for fake crimes, TRAI threatening to disconnect your SIM, OTP phishing, fake job offer calls asking for money, courier fraud (claiming a parcel is seized by customs), and electricity disconnection threats.
Major Indian city codes include: Mumbai (022), Delhi (011), Bangalore (080), Chennai (044), Kolkata (033), Hyderabad (040), Ahmedabad (079), Pune (020), Jaipur (0141), and Lucknow (0522). These area codes follow the country code +91 in international format.
